A respected recruitment firm is looking for an experienced Commercial Finance Broker in London. This mid-senior level role involves helping businesses access essential funding solutions and building long-lasting client relationships.

Candidates should have a background in banking and a strong understanding of commercial finance. This position offers a competitive salary along with a market-leading commission structure, and a chance to work in a professional environment.
